Transfer insider Dean Jones has thrown N'Golo Kante's Chelsea career into doubt by suggesting that this season could be his last at Stamford Bridge.
What's the latest with Kante?
The French World Cup winner has established himself as one of the best defensive midfielders in European football in recent seasons but has entered the final two years of his Blues contract, which has raised concerns over his future in west London.
However, speaking before the recent European Championships, the 30-year-old shut down any claims about him leaving by admitting that he isn't thinking about his future and hopes to remain with the club for many more years to come.
What has Jones said about Kante?
Jones revealed there's a possibility that the 2021-2022 could be Kante's sixth and final season with the European champions despite his incredible impact over the previous five years.
He told GIVEMESPORT: "What's N'Golo Kante's long-term future? Is he going to stay at Chelsea beyond this season? There's a possibility he won't."
How has Kante fared at Chelsea?
Unbelievably well. He's only got better since helping Leicester to their Premier League triumph – and besides the Carabao Cup, has won everything during his time in England.

He marked his first season at Chelsea with another league title and FA Cup, Europa League and Champions League medals have since followed for the midfielder, who produced a man of the match performance in the final of the latter to help Chelsea defeat Manchester City back in May.
Kante has also won the small matter of the World Cup with France during that period to establish himself as one of the most decorated English-based players in recent years.
With Chelsea going from strength to strength under Thomas Tuchel, and Kante still one of the best in his position in world football, he'd be mad to even consider leaving the Stamford Bridge outfit just yet.
